Selena Gomez shares emotional video in tears responding to new Donald Trump order

Selena Gomez broke down in tears on her Instagram story on Monday (27 January)

Joshua Nair

Joshua Nair

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

Selena Gomez shared a candid video with fans on her social media accounts today (27 January).

The 'Wolves' singer has been an outspoken supporter of immigration in the past, but the actions of Donald Trump in his first week in office were enough to bring her to tears.

Gomez's video came just a day after 956 people were arrested in a nationwide immigration crackdown the BBC reports, in one of the bills that Trump signed as President after taking his place in the Oval Office.

Other bills include pardoning 1,500 US Capitol rioters and for the nation to only recognise two genders.

Despite being born in Texas, US, Gomez's father is of Mexican descent and she feels close to that part of her heritage, having previously called herself a 'proud third-generation American-Mexican'.

The 32-year-old then posted a now-deleted video on Instagram, where she could be seen in tears, sobbing and expressing her sadness at Trump's bill aimed at cutting down on immigration.

Captioning the video 'I'm sorry' with a Mexican flag emoji, she said: “All my people are getting attacked, the children. I don’t understand.

"I’m so sorry, I wish I could do something but I can’t. I don’t know what to do. I’ll try everything, I promise,” she concluded, while wiping her tears away.

Soon after, she took the video down and posted a black screen with the caption: “Apparently it’s not ok to show empathy for people.”

Prior to the arrest of 956 people on Sunday (26 January), the most in one day since Trump became the 47th US President, the BBC further reported that 286 arrests were made on Saturday, as well as 593 on Friday, and 538 on Thursday.

ICE statistics further reveal that more than 1,000 people were removed or repatriated on Thursday.

The President called the situation at the US-Mexico border a 'national emergency', giving the green light for American armed forces to police the border as part of the new order.

It further declared that Mexican drug cartels are classed as 'foreign terrorist organisations', while automatic citizenship that used to be granted to children of undocumented immigrants that were born in the country will now be limited.

American citizenship is now described as 'a priceless and profound gift' in the order.

A further executive order also suspended the US Refugee Admissions Programme.

It stated that this would be 'until such time as the further entry into the United States of refugees aligns with the interests of the United States'.

It reads: "The Secretary of State and the Secretary of Homeland Security may jointly determine to admit aliens to the United States as refugees on a case-by-case basis, in their discretion, but only so long as they determine that the entry of such aliens as refugees is in the national interest and does not pose a threat to the security or welfare of the United States."
